Consolation in Christ. — Exhortation would be better, inasmuch as consolation anticipates the comfort of the next phrase. Comfort of love. —Encouragement which love gives. Fellowship of the Spirit. Webb14 apr. 2024 · Commentary on Philippians 2:5-11. The hymn in Philippians opens up a different dimension of Palm/Passion Sunday. There is no triumphal entry into Jerusalem, no last supper, no betrayal by Judas, no complicit religious leaders, and no Roman overlords.
